Marking Earl Weaver's 1,000th victory as manager, the Orioles opened their season by defeating the White Sox, 5-3, behind the three-hit pitching of Jim Palmer. The White Sox nicked Palmer for two runs in the second inning, but the Orioles came back to take command with three in their half.

Rich Dauer batted in the tying pair with a bases-loaded single and, after Rick Dempsey singled Dauer to third, Mark Belanger hit a sacrifice fly to put the Orioles ahead. Doug DeCinces, who batted in at least one run in each of the last 10 games of the 1978 season, made it 11 in a row with an infield out that produced what proved to be the Orioles' deciding tally in the fifth.
